Transaction b568979ed2f8136c44e199b79563ab8583b5b159eaade6629a4daa73a617fe29
2 Input
2 Outputs
- b568979ed2f8136c44e199b79563ab8583b5b159eaade6629a4daa73a617fe29:0
- b568979ed2f8136c44e199b79563ab8583b5b159eaade6629a4daa73a617fe29:1
value 802000
address 19afhnta2Xyc11xpKH15d1gogPhW544PGw
value 18060016
address 18cUCJTafUEVX2pFYKfW16nESecbpnRbn8